| 20110107020 | HIBERNATION SOLUTION FOR EMBEDDED DEVICES AND SYSTEMS - An embedded device is hibernated by storing state data of the embedded device to a non-volatile data storage medium, and powering off the embedded device. The embedded device is later woken up in response to the detection of a wakeup event from a wakeup source. The state data stored in the RAM of the embedded device comprises data in one or more registers of a Central Processing Unit (CPU) of the embedded device, one or more registers of a system-on-chip (SOC) of the embedded device, and the system and applications code and data. Waking the embedded device comprises loading, from the non-volatile data storage medium, initial memory sections that are used to run a kernel of the embedded device. State data that is stored in the RAM of a system may be compressed by dividing the RAM into a plurality of sections and independently choosing, for each section in the plurality of sections, a corresponding compression arithmetic. | 05-05-2011 |

| 20110122659 | POWER TRANSISTOR DRIVING CIRCUITS AND METHODS FOR SWITCHING MODE POWER SUPPLIES - A power supply controller is provided for providing a drive current to a control terminal of a power transistor in three time intervals. The controller includes control circuits configured to control the drive current in multiple stages. During a first time interval, first drive current includes a current spike for turning on the power transistor in response to a start of the control signal pulse. During a second time interval, a second drive current includes a ramping current substantially proportional to a magnitude of a current through the power transistor. During a third time interval, current flow to the power transistor is at least partially turned off before an end of the control signal pulse. | 05-26-2011 |

| 20100327314 | Insulated Gate Bipolar Transistor (IGBT) Collector Formed with Ge/A1 and Production Method - This invention discloses an IGBT device with its collector formed with Ge/Al and associated method of fabrication. The collector is formed on the substrate layer, which is on the back of IGBT, and contains Ge and Al thin films. After thinning and etching the back side of IGBT substrate, Ge and Al are sequentially deposited to form Ge/Al thin films on the back surface of the substrate. An annealing process is then carried out to diffuse Al into Ge thin film layer to form a P-doped Ge layer functioning as the IGBT collector. The present invention is applicable to both non punch through IGBTs as well as punch through IGBTs. | 12-30-2010 |
